BS25 is a smaller North Somerset district with 278 postcodes. Fibre-to-the-premises infrastructure has achieved near-universal penetration at 78.3 per cent.
Broadband speeds in BS25
Share of BS25 premises by the fastest download speed available, averaged across all 278 postcodes in the district.
BS25 across its 278 postcodes shows selective deployment suited to this smaller district. Full fibre availability reaches 78.3 per cent, reflecting targeted investment in primary areas rather than detailed coverage. Superfast and ultrafast protection reach 95.8 per cent and 78.3 per cent respectively, with superfast extending beyond the FTTP footprint via VDSL technology. Speed distribution shows strong capability at the high end: 78.3 per cent of postcodes support gigabit-speed services (300+ Mbps).
A further 17.5 per cent achieve 30 to 300 Mbps rates, typically using older fibre or copper technology. Below-10 Mbps postcodes remain negligible. Just 0.7 per cent falls below the universal service obligation, indicating residual coverage gaps in rural fringe areas. This district represents efficient fibre deployment in a smaller geographic footprint, prioritising infrastructure investment where population density justifies the cost. For households in gigabit areas, speed competition and provider choice should support competitive pricing. Those in the VDSL tier can expect solid superfast performance adequate for most household uses.
Source: Ofcom Connected Nations. Percentages are district-wide averages of postcode-level availability, so rows may not sum to exactly 100%.

BS25 broadband FAQs
How much of BS25 has full fibre?
78.3 per cent of the 278 postcodes in BS25 have full fibre access. This matches the gigabit capability figure.
What percentage of BS25 cannot reach 10 Mbps?
0.7 per cent, roughly two postcodes. These fall outside the universal service obligation coverage.
Where does BS25 stand on superfast availability?
95.8 per cent of postcodes reach superfast speeds, above the UK baseline.
Are gigabit and full fibre the same in BS25?
Yes. Both measure 78.3 per cent, indicating the cable network infrastructure does not contribute gigabit availability here.
